Transaction 28670cbccd4e8af4690d8055c21edaa510e3556cabda38fbe581f9931bc10f24
1 Input
2 Outputs
- 28670cbccd4e8af4690d8055c21edaa510e3556cabda38fbe581f9931bc10f24:0
- 28670cbccd4e8af4690d8055c21edaa510e3556cabda38fbe581f9931bc10f24:1
value 994872
address 1Jk6BsKcuvFCqgyCWs5Hg7KNK77DfqynCf
value 1244864
address 1KqDz3StByC1dBhKNPu3cixRc52x31fS4R